Brief Overview of a Knowledge-Based Software

When it comes to customer self-service in CX, you need to leverage the best software with useful features. This is where knowledge-based software can help you level up your CX game.

The software provides information that can enable your customers to have a better experience while using your products and services, along with a lot of self-service options for simple tasks. It works by helping businesses organize their working knowledge as useful content in a searchable data directory. Advanced software also uses automation and machine learning to respond to customer inquiries via relevant articles from the database.

Some of the common data provided in a knowledge base are -

  • FAQs

  • Troubleshooting guides to resolve customer issues.

  • Product and service descriptions to help consumers understand the company's features in detail.

  • Onboarding flows for customers.

Common Benefits of Using Knowledge-Based Software for Customer Self-Service in CX

Using a customer service management tool, like knowledge-based software, can be beneficial in the following ways -

  • A well-managed knowledge base (both external and internal) can help your business perform better, and support teams can use the data created by using the knowledge base to document problem-solving responses.

  • It can help track feature requests and document product development, and it can also be a resourceful tool to communicate internal information to employees.

  • With knowledge-based software, the customer support team will be able to create content that helps consumers, leading to better outcomes.

  • An external knowledge-based software, one your customers can utilize, provides various self-service options, from onboarding customers to explaining your products & services.

Top 5 Knowledge-Based Software for Customer Support You Need to Know About


Zendesk

By offering a lean and confident content solution, Zendesk has made it to the top of the knowledge base software list in 2022. The USP of the software is that it is easy to use by the business internally and also by customers. Customer and support agents can use the self-service portal to find the right info and respond to queries 24*7.

With 40 different languages, the software provides a localized experience to customers, and it also provides insights to help businesses bridge the gap between the current content and customer's expectations. Some other features of Zendesk include customizable branding, AI-enabled bots, and community forums.


Bloomfire

If you need a tool that centralizes company knowledge in a single, searchable platform, then Bloomfire is the right software choice. It helps support agents deliver contextually relevant service consistently, leading to a better customer experience.

With AI capabilities and crowd-sourced FAQs, the platform imitates social media by allowing user interactions. The software becomes more affordable if you have more than 50 users and can help you with many self-service portal features, including API access, content reporting, and customer feedback.


Wix Answers

This intuitive knowledge base software can work wonders for small and medium-sized enterprises. Wix Answers helps businesses build a website with minimal resources and also facilitates them with a call center, live chat, and ticketing system features. By helping with customer surveys, reporting, and discussion forums, it makes customers feel seen and helps brands analyze their customer's views better.


USU Knowledge Center

This cloud-based management software has a powerful search feature along with collaboration tools to help agents escalate issues more easily. The software integrates with SAP, Microsoft Dynamics, Zendesk, and Sales Force and provides customizable branding and other self-service portal features, like voicebots, chatbots, and usage tracking. USU Knowledge Center also facilitates businesses with a consistent editorial process for content creation, updates, and removal.


Intellum Platform

Intellum platform is another customer service management tool that can be used to educate 10,000+ employees and customers. It includes not only a knowledge base but also a learning management system. The self-service portal helps with customer feedback and provides detailed analytics for the business. With real-time collaboration tools, design customization, and categorization, this platform is worth considering.
